ABSTRACT

This study aims to examine the impact of emotional intelligence on the work stress of the Al-Ajami Educational Administration. This study used a questionnaire prepared for this purpose. For achieving study goals, the analytical descriptive methodology is used through many; statistical approaches especially multiple regression analysis for testing the effect of more than an independent variable on one dependent variable and hierarchical regression analysis for measuring the adjusted effect of work stress. A randomized stratified sample of the study population was selected by (401) individuals with a response rate of (80.2%). The results of the study showed a significant effect of emotional intelligence on work stress. According to the findings, some recommendations are: Organizations should pay more attention to emotional intelligence and its role in reducing work stress.
